Georgia’s debt to Azerbaijan remains unchanged

As of April 1, 2019, Georgia’s debt to Azerbaijan made up $7.435 million, remaining unchanged compared to the previous month, Report’s Georgian bureau informs citing Finance Ministry.
Georgia’s total external debt made up $5,388,974,000. Government accounts for $5,222,384,000 of this amount.
Georgia’s debt to Germany, France and Japan amounted to $320.233 million, $248.481 million and $212.609 million respectively.
Georgia’s debt to Turkey, Russia and Armenia remained unchanged at $14.273 million, $58.773 million and $8.305 million respectively.
